Since SRCC is actively involved with the City of Austin Watershed Protection, and water quality remains a critical issue for the city overall, it is important for all of us to continuously be aware of watershed challenges as Austin grows. Elloa Matthews and the Austin Flood Mitigation Task Force (FMTF) have provided this helpful overview with infographics on the health of the District 9 watershed today. District 9 encompasses the downtown and UT campus areas.

The FMTF calls out priority problem areas with erosion and flooding concerns, and details Watershed Protection Department programs and capital projects in place to improve the District 9 watershed. Please review the profile document and also consult the Watershed Protection Department website.
